Hello Aspirant,
The most important topic of IIT JAM in Chemistry are:-
Physical Chemistry:-
1. Solid State
2. Quantum Chemistry
3. Electrochemistry
4. Chemistry Kinetics
5. Thermodynamics
Inorganic Chemistry:-
1. Co-ordination Compounds
2. Chemical Bonding
3. Organometallic Compounds
4. Bio inorganic Chemistry
Organic Chemistry:-
1. Stereo Chemistry
2. Name Reactions
